PHP - php_function_openssl_pkey_get_private()
Definition and Usage
The openssl_pkey_get_private() function will return you the private key.
Description
The function openssl_pkey_get_private() returns private key from the given public/private key. For example contents from .pem file.
Syntax
openssl_pkey_get_private ( mixed $key [, string $passphrase = "" ] ) : resource
Parameters
| Sr.No | Parameter | Description |
|---|---|---|
| 1 |
key |
You can take the key from the .pem file or using private key generated from openssl_pkey_new(). |
| 2 |
passphrase |
If they key you are using is encrypted , than you will have to specify passphrase. |
Return Values
PHP openssl_pkey_get_private() function returns a resource identifier if there is no error. It will return false if the key generation fails.
PHP Version
This function will work from PHP Version greater than 5.0.0.
Example 1
Working of openssl_pkey_get_private():
<?php
// Generate a new private (and public) key pair
$privkey = openssl_pkey_new();
openssl_pkey_export($privkey, $yourprivatekey);
$testprivatekey = openssl_pkey_get_private($yourprivatekey);
if ($testprivatekey === false) {
var_dump(openssl_error_string());
} else {
var_dump($testprivatekey);
}
?>
This will produce the following result:
resource(3) of type (OpenSSL key)
Example 2
Working of openssl_pkey_get_private() and openssl_pkey_get_details()
<?php
$privkey = openssl_pkey_new();
openssl_pkey_export($privkey, $yourprivatekey);
$testprivatekey = openssl_pkey_get_private($yourprivatekey);
if ($testprivatekey === false) {
var_dump(openssl_error_string());
} else {
//var_dump($testprivatekey);
$key_details = openssl_pkey_get_details($testprivatekey);
print_r($key_details);
}
?>
This will produce the following result:

Example 3
Working of openssl_pkey_get_private() with passphrase:
<?php
$privkey = openssl_pkey_new();
openssl_pkey_export($privkey, $testkey, 'helloworld');
$testprivatekey = openssl_pkey_get_private($testkey, 'helloworld');
if ($testprivatekey === false) {
var_dump(openssl_error_string());
} else {
//var_dump($testprivatekey);
$key_details = openssl_pkey_get_details($testprivatekey);
print_r($key_details);
}
?>
This will produce the following result:

Example 4
Working of openssl_pkey_get_private() with .pem file:
<?php
//creating private key
$privkey = openssl_pkey_new();
openssl_pkey_export_to_file($privkey, 'C:/xampp/htdocs/modules/openssl/fortesting.pem');
//using .pem file with private key.
$testprivatekey = openssl_pkey_get_private(file_get_contents('C:/xampp/htdocs/modules/openssl/fortesting.pem'));
if ($testprivatekey === false) {
var_dump(openssl_error_string());
} else {
//var_dump($testprivatekey);
$key_details = openssl_pkey_get_details($testprivatekey);
print_r($key_details);
}
?>
This will produce the following result:
